Canley Crematorium sits along Cannon Hill Road in south Coventry, approached through quiet residential streets that help create a sense of stepping away from the bustle of daily life. The grounds offer space for reflection, whilst the building itself maintains the dignified, understated character typical of Britain's mid-20th century crematoria. Families arriving here often find the setting feels appropriately removed from the main city centre, allowing for the focused atmosphere that such occasions require.
When planning your time after the service, you'll find Canley Crematorium well-positioned for travelling to various parts of Coventry and the surrounding West Midlands area. The crematorium's location means reasonable journey times to community halls, hotels, and pubs throughout the city, whether you're heading towards the centre or staying in the southern suburbs. For older relatives or those with mobility concerns, the level approach and parking arrangements typically accommodate family cars well, though you may wish to arrive a few minutes early to settle everyone comfortably before the service begins.

Canley Crematorium provides on-site parking for families and mourners attending services. You'll find the car park adjacent to the crematorium buildings on Cannon Hill Road. It's advisable to arrive a few minutes early to allow time for parking and gathering with other family members before the service begins. The parking area is designed to accommodate the needs of funeral parties, including space for funeral vehicles.
Upon arrival at Canley Crematorium, you'll be greeted by crematorium staff who will guide you to the appropriate chapel. The grounds are maintained as peaceful, respectful spaces with landscaped areas for quiet reflection. Staff will ensure you know where to gather before the service and will coordinate with your funeral director to ensure everything proceeds smoothly. There are usually seating areas available if you need to wait before the service begins.
Canley Crematorium is designed to accommodate visitors with mobility needs, including elderly relatives and those using wheelchairs or walking aids. The chapel and main facilities are accessible, with level access and appropriate facilities. If you have specific accessibility requirements, it's worth discussing these with your funeral director in advance so they can liaise with the crematorium staff to ensure everything is properly arranged for your family's needs.
The area around Canley Crematorium offers various options for holding a wake or reception after the service. You'll find local pubs, community centres, and hotel function rooms within a few miles that can accommodate funeral gatherings. Many families also choose nearby restaurants or golf clubs that offer private dining areas. Your funeral director can often recommend suitable venues in the vicinity, or you might consider somewhere that held special meaning for your loved one.
When planning your day around the service at Canley Crematorium, it's wise to allow at least 30 to 45 minutes between the end of the crematorium service and the start of any wake or reception. This gives mourners time to offer condolences, spend a few quiet moments in the grounds if they wish, and travel to the wake venue. Your funeral director can help coordinate the timing to ensure a smooth transition between the service and any subsequent gathering.
